local nit = require(path.to.nit)
Function | Description |
---|---|
nit.register(provider, name) |
registers a provider with an optional name |
nit.use(provider, priority) |
marks a provider as used and assigns it a priority |
nit.createProvider(provider) |
creates a empty provider |
nit.loadDescendants(parent, predicate) |
loads all descendant providers of a parent with a optional predicate |
nit.loadChildren(parent, predicate) |
loads all children providers of a parent with optional predicate |
nit.ignite() |
starts the framework, initializing and running registered providers |

Lifecycle | Description |
---|---|
onInit | Runs lifecycles sequentially before ignition |
onStart | Runs lifecycles at once post ignition |
onTick | Equivalent to RunService.Heartbeat |
onPhysics | Equivalent to RunService.Stepped |
onRender | Client only, equivalent to RunService.RenderStepped |
boilerplate
-- boilerplate.luau
local nit = require("nit")
local provider = nit.createProvider({})
return nit.register(provider, "myProviderName") -- Name is optional.
-- registering with a name makes it a singleton

plugins extend the core framework. they should be loaded before nit.ignite()
. initalize plugins using the nit:extend()
method
-- Instance.luau
return {
create = Instance.new,
fromExisting = Instance.fromExisting
}
-- main.client.luau
local nit = require("nit")
local instance = require(path.to.Instance)
nit = nit:extend(instance) -- extend nit with the plugin
--
print(nit.create("Part").ClassName == "Part") -- true
Caution
make sure to use nit:extend instead of nit.extend or else you will have to manually pass nit into the extend call nit.extend(nit, ...)
